AVIATION
MOIR’S FLIGHT. (United Press Association— By Electric Telegraph—Copy right). (Received this day at 8 a.m.) SINGAPORE, May 13. Nloir and Owen arrived at noon aftei an ‘ uneventful flight from Singora. 'lhe propeller was slightly damaged. Thev are leaving for Java to-morrow.
